The 425 area code, primarily covering King, Snohomish, and Kittitas Counties, reflects diverse demographics with a sizable population of over three million. Majority of residents identify as White, with a significant Asian community, revealing considerable racial diversity. Economically, the area has experienced robust growth, with median household incomes rising significantly above the national average over the past decade. The population has steadily increased, suggesting a desirable living area with favorable economic trends.
According to FCC complaint metrics, the 425 area code has seen notable shifts in call complaint patterns from 2014 to 2024. Complaints about wireless/mobile calls peaked in 2018, while wired complaints have declined. Prerecorded voice complaints surged in 2018, signaling an increase in automated call issues. Abandoned calls and robocalls, once prevalent, have decreased significantly in recent years. This indicates changing communication patterns, likely influenced by advancements in telecommunications and regulatory measures. The labor market also depicts strong performance, with a stable labor force participation rate and a declining unemployment rate, emphasizing the area's growing employment opportunities.
